In my communion time with the Lord this morning the Holy Spirit prompted me to look at Luke.5:1-11 where Jesus requested to use Peter’s boat that was stationery. His intention was to teach the people about the Kingdom who had come to hear Him who were pushing to get close to Him by the shore of lake Galilee.
Now Peter and Co who were fishermen had a bad night fishing and had not caught any fish even though they had toiled all night long using their nets with bait to attract the fish. The nets needed to be cleaned and Peter was around the shoreline securing the nets, washing and checking to see if they were broken. Also checking the boat to ensure it was anchored and had no leaks.
Jesus on the other hand had a plan for that business that morning that involved all the partners of the business which was going to change their lives eternally. However, they had to agree to the plan of Jesus by allowing the Lord the permission to use what they had, which were their boats. This was necessary so Jesus could truly bless and reward them for putting their boat to be used to preach the Kingdom.
They had to give first which we generally don’t want to do but that’s the way to get God involved in your life.Genesis.8:22. Peter needed to be willing to allow Jesus to use his boat to preach the gospel of the Kingdom which he did. So Jesus proceeded to use the boat to reach out to those pressing to hear Him.
Once Jesus finished sharing, He gave instructions to Peter on what they needed to do to now catch fish. Remember they were the experts at that and now Jesus the preacher is telling them to go fishing in an arena where there was so much noise.
However Peter was discerning enough to do as Mary had advised the servants at the marriage feast in Canaan in John.2. That whatever Jesus tells you to do; just do it. This is because Jesus’ words never fail to produce great results.
Peter partially obeys by dropping down one broken net and amazingly learns something new about how to fish. That lesson of wisdom from Jesus that money cannot buy which relationship with Jesus alone brings into your life.
We need to admit that Jesus is Lord over all things and knows more about all things, including fishing because He created all things including fish and their habitat the water. Peter is convicted of his sin as the miracle catch happens and requests Jesus to depart from him because he is a sinful man.
Jesus responds by saying to Peter you are who I am looking for so follow Me and I will make you a fisher of men. Having seen the Kingdom in action in the marketplace Peter immediately leaves fishing with the other three partners in that company to follow Jesus.
They embark on a new pursuit in life following Jesus to become fishers of men. Imagine the new opportunities that were added to their lives as they would now travel around so many Cities and different scenes of life with Jesus meeting so many different people and watch Him heal, deliver and raise from the dead different people.
